While the acronym FT often stands for the Fourier Transform, it also has another meaning for both of us— one that we encountered long before we became familiar with its mathematical use. For students in the Czech Republic during the mid‐80s, as far as we were concerned, it could only refer to Frantisek (Frank) Turecek….. With this wording, we initiated the special Mass Spectrometry Reviews issue honoring Frank Turecek from the University of Washington, which has already been completed (https://lnkd.in/dssSuCE6). This issue comprises articles submitted by Frank's colleagues and friends from America, Europe, and Asia. It commences with two reminiscence articles and then advances to reviews on the fundamental and biomedical applications of mass spectrometry, which were always of significant interest to Frank. https://lnkd.in/dfx8uey8 https://lnkd.in/df_ApDTQ https://lnkd.in/dWvGeQWw https://lnkd.in/dn9Tj64Y https://lnkd.in/deB3UFQf https://lnkd.in/dnwtSAuu https://lnkd.in/dUXsEFAg Frank’s scientific record is extraordinary. Evaluating the performance of frontier LLMs on scientific interpretation and reasoning tasks is challenging to do well, but critical to developing these models for use in scientific research. Here we report LAB-Bench - a set of ~2,500 questions which do just that.
Today FutureHouse released ~2,500 hard bio evals that test lab protocol design, scientific literature RAG, sequence design, figure understanding, table understanding, and more. We benchmarked against >10 independent PhD-level experts. Frontier LLMs do not yet exceed humans. Making this required setting up a large pool of experts in experimental biology - which was a big task to begin with. Next - we designed question that we believe test an LLM reasoning ability, not knowledge, and built questions across the biology accordingly. Finally - to check for contamination or training on evals - we withheld 20%.
